Why the Senedd should reject flawed gender quota Bill
On Tuesday (16 July), the Senedd will be asked to approve the general principles of the Senedd Cymru (Electoral Candidate Lists) Bill. This Bill would impose a statutory ‘gender’ quota to the new proportional representation electoral system. Our response to the consultation is on our website.
To summarise our concerns:
The Bill is a blunt instrument that does nothing to address the underlying systemic barriers leading to women’s under-representation in politics.
The failure of the Bill to define the key terms ‘woman’ and ‘gender’ or to refer to the correct protected characteristic of ‘sex’ would effectively introduce a form of self-ID to Wales. This is undemocratic and would breach the Equality Act 2010.
The Bill is not within the legislative competence of the Senedd and will inevitably be subject to a costly, reputationally damaging legal challenge.
